The Ohana Waikiki Beachcomber is a 3-star hotel located in the heart of Waikiki on Kalakaua Avenue. Just steps to Waikiki Beach, the property is adjacent to the open air International Marketplace (a greatplace for souvenirs) and across the street from the Royal Hawaiian Shopping Center, home to multi-culturaldining and designer boutiques.
This older property was recently taken over by the Outrigger/Ohana hotel chain and has recentlyundergone a multi-million dollar renovation of all rooms, guest corridors and elevators. The WaikikiBeachcomber has a well trained staff, impressive service and is a perfect, family friendly spot for thosewho want a clean, well run hotel with reasonable prices and a great location.
The hotel features an impressive package of complimentary amenities, including internet access, localand long distance phone calls to the Continental U.S. and Canada (first 15 minutes free), in-room safe,in-room coffee daily, local newspaper, digital pagers for early check-in guests and passes for all guestsin the room (up to 5 days) on the Waikiki Trolley's Pink Line that goes throughout Waikiki and to AlaMoana Shopping Center.
For guests that arrive before the normal 3 p.m. check-in time, the Ohana Waikiki Beachcomber hasluggage storage available, as well as hospitality rooms for late departures. There are also ADAaccessible rooms and Hearing Impaired Rooms with a TDD machine.
Other property amenities include complimentary wireless internet access in the lobby, 24-hour receptiondesk, ample covered parking (fee), a swimming pool on the third level with sun deck and spa tub, laundryfacilities and sundries store. There is a Macy's on the ground floor with a good selection of clothing,makeup and other items, including beachwear and aloha attire, in case you've forgotten to packsomething.
The Ohana Waikiki Beachcomber just completed a multi-million dollar renovation of all their rooms witha wonderful palette of tropical hues and sandstone, great compliments to the property's ocean views. Theair conditioned guestrooms have enhanced custom bedding, dark alder and cherry hardwood furnishings,artwork and private lanais.
Room amenities include 32-inch flat screen TV, alarm clock/radio with MP3 player, voice mail,refrigerator, in-room safe, coffee/tea maker with complimentary coffee and tea, newspapers delivered tothe room, iron/board, hairdryer and more. Children 17 years and younger are free when staying withparents and using existing bedding.
The hotel is home to the wonderful Magic of Polynesia, featuring Hawaii's own well known illusionist,John Hirokawa. Located on the lobby level, the 700-seat theater was specifically designed for hiselectrifying displays. Shows are on Tuesday through Saturday with dinner and show or show only seating. The property's Hibiscus Café has been closed and work has begun on the new 400-seat Jimmy Buffett'sat the Beachcomber's restaurant and showroom, scheduled to open in early 2009.
